The main façade of the Academy of Arts overlooks the Neva.

The building was designed by the architects Alexander Kokorinov and Jean Batist Vallin de la 35 Mothe in 1764.

The construction of the building was finished in 1788.

It is one of the vivid examples of early Classicism in Russian architecture.

Over the entrance there is an inscription in bronze letters ‗To Free Arts.

The year of 1765‖.

It was the first building in classic style in Saint Petersburg.

The well - balanced proportions of the main façade are particularly impressive.

Now the building houses the Saint Petersburg Repin Institute of Painting, Sculpture and Architecture.

The idea of creation of a Russia artistic school belonged to Peter I but it was realized only partially at that time.

In 1757, Count Ivan Shuvalov came forward with a project to create the Academy of Fine arts.

The Academy of the Three Most Noble Arts (painting, sculpture and architecture) was founded in 1757.

The first students graduated from the Academy in 1762.

The academy of Arts has played an important role in the development of Russian art.

A lot of famous Russian painters and sculptors studied and worked there.

At the beginning of the 19th century, the graduates of the Academy of Arts deserved the European recognition.

Переведите пожалуйста Theatre Square Theatre Square was shaped in the second part of the 18th century.

It was the venue for popular festivals, amateur performances and mounted games with theatrical elements.

In 1765, a wooden theatre was built there.

Between 1775 and 1783, the Bolshoy or Stone Theatre was erected by the design of Antonio Rinaldi.

For a long time the Bolshoy ranked with the best theatres of Europe and remained the largest theatre in Europe.

The theatre was rebuilt many times, burnt down and erected again from the ashes.

Operas, ballets and plays were staged at that theatre.

Its auditorium had three tiers and accommodated about 2000 spectators.

But it was rebuilt in the first decade of the 19th century by Jean - Francais Thomas de Thomon.

Then the St.

Petersburg Conservatoire was housed in this building.

The first institution of higher musical education in Russia was founded in 1862 on the initiative of the composer Anton Rubinshtein.

Pyotr Tchaikovsky was one of the first graduates of the Conservatoire.

Many outstanding composers and musicians, including Sergey Prokofyev and Dmitry Shostakovich, studied in it.

In 1944, the Conservatoire was named after the great Russian composer Nikolay Rimsky - Korsakov.

Next to the Conservatoire there are two monuments to the outstanding Russian composers.

The monument to Nikolay Rimsky - Korsakov was designed by sculptors Veniamin Bogolyubov and Victor Ingal and erected in 1952.

The monument too Mikhail Glinka is the creation of the sculptor Robert Bakh.

It was mounted in 1906.

Opposite the Conservatoire stands the Mariinsky Theatre.

Between 1847 and 1849, a circus - theatre was built on this site.

After the fire of 1859, the building was reconstructed according to the design of the architect Albert Kavos.

The appearance of the building, its main façade is a result of the reconstruction undertaken between 1894 and 1895 under the supervision of the architect Victor Schroter.

The new theatre was named the Mariinsky Theatre after Maria Alexandrovna, the wife of Alexander II.

The theatre was inaugurated on the 2nd of 20 October, 1860 with the opera ―Life for the Tsar‖ (―Ivan Susanin‖) by Mikhail Glinka.

Fiodor Shaliapin, Leonid Sobinov sang on the scene of this theatre.

Anna Pavlova, Tamara Karsavina, Mathilda Kshesinskaya, Vaslav Nizhinsky, Mikhail Fokin, Galina Ulanova and other outstanding actors danced there.

Many works by the greatest composers were performed on its stage for the first time.

For several years the ballet company was headed by Maurice Petipa.

The stalls and five circles of the auditorium have 2000 seats to accommodate spectators.

The Mariinsky Theatre is famous all over the world by its preserved traditions of Russian classic ballet.

Переведите пожалуйста The Sheremetev Palace This palace is known as well by the name ‗the Fountain House‖, as it overlooks the River Fontanka.

This building is a remarkable monument of the 18th century Russian architecture.

In 1712, Peter the great presented this plot of land to Field Marshal Boris Sheremetev.

Count Boris Sheremetev didn‘t live there himself, because he had a splendid house near the present Millionnaya street.

The first owner of the house was his son, count Pyotr Sheremetev.

First, between 1720 and 1740, the wooden building was erected, but it was reconstructed between 1750 and 1755 by two outstanding architects Fyodor Argunov and Savva Chevakinsky.

The big two - storeyed stone palace was built.

There were three parts : the main building and two wings.

The building was decorated with moulded heads over the windows and beautiful ornamentation.

There were service rooms, kunstkammer and weapons room on the first floor of the palace.

The main apartments were situated on the second floor.

They were decorated with gold - plated carvings, painted ceilings and panels.

Lots of the furniture, paintings, bronze objects and sets of dishes were brought from Europe.

Behind the palace a spacious park was laid.

It was a big regular garden with classical sculptures and fountains.

There was a grotto, a Chinese bower and the Hermitage pavilion.

Later this place was sold and the dwelling - houses were built there.

28 In front of the palace there is a great railing.

This railing was made after the design of the architect Ieronim Corsini between 1837 and 1838.

The gates are decorated with the Sheremetev‘s coat of arms.

In the left part of the main yard the single - storeyed service house with gates was built in 1867.

This building was designed by the architect Nicholay Benois.

In the middle of the 19th century the palace was occupied by the Field Marshal‘s descendant, Nicholay Sheremetev.

He was one of the richest men in Russia.

The composer Mikhail Glinka used to visit the palace.

When the artist Orest Kiprensky lived in this house, Alexander Pushkin sat for him.

Kiprensky painred his portrait.

The poetess Anna Akhmatova lived here for the great part of her life from 1924 till 1952.

She deserved the title of the ―Sappho of the 20th century‖.

Her muse was lyric and she also expressed the tragedy of her Mother - land in her poems.

Nowadays, in the flat of Anna Akhmatova a memorial museum is located.

After 1917, in the Sheremetev Palace a museum of the everyday life of nobility was established.

In 1990, the palace was given to the Museum of Theatre and Music.

St.

Petersburg, one of the most beautiful cities of Europe, has played an important role in Russian history.

Founded by Peter I the Great in 1703 it was the capital of the Russian Empire for two centuries.

St. Petersburg was the scene of two revolutions.

After the revolutions of 1917 it was renamed into Leningrad and became the capital of the new Republic.

During World War II the city was besieged and fiercely defended.

St. Petersburg is situated on the Neva river.

The city once spread across nearly 100 islands.

Canals and natural channels make St.

Petersburg a city of waterways and bridges.

The modern city is important as a cultural and industrial centre and as the nation's largest seaport.

In 1991 St.

Petersburg got its original name back.

Central St.

Petersburg is divided by the Neva River into four parts : the Admiralty Side, Vasilyevsky Island, the Petrograd Side, and the Vyborg Side.

The Admiralty Side is rich in museums, monuments, historical buildings and squares.

From the Admiralty, the heart of Peter's city, an avenue known as Nevsky Prospect runs eastward.

There are a lot of palaces, churches, stores, cafes, and theatres there.

St. Petersburg is proud of its rich architecture that includes the cathedral of the Peter - Paul Fortress, the Summer Palace, the Winter Palace, the Smolny Convent, the Kazan and St.

Isaac's cathedrals, the Smolny Institute, the new Admiralty, and the Senate.

There are many important educational and scientific research centres in St.

Petersburg.

Among these are : the University of Saint Petersburg, the Academy of Fine Arts, the Institute of Mines, and the Military Medical Academy.

St. Petersburg is a city of culture.

There are a lot of theatres and concert halls there.

The Mariinsky Theatre has long enjoyed an international reputation, and its resident company is frequently on tour abroad.

Other important theatres are the Mali, Gorky, Pushkin, and Musical Comedy theatres.

Famous museums include the State Russian Museum, which specialises in Russian painting, and the Hermitage with a rich collection of western European painting.

In 1764 the Hermitage was founded by Catherine II the Great as a court museum.

It was opened to the public in 1852!

After the October Revolution of 1917, the imperial collections became public property.

The Hermitage has a rich collection of western European painting since the Middle Ages, including many masterpieces by Renaissance Italian and Baroque Dutch, Flemish, and French painters.

Russian art is well represented.

The Hermitage also has extensive holdings of Oriental art.

In St.

Petersburg there are many stadiums and other outdoor recreation facilities provided by the Zoo, the botanical gardens, and numerous other parks and gardens.

The construction of the Moscow Kremlin as a red - brick stone fortress began in the late 15th century.

At that time Ivan III ruled over the united Russian state, and he invited Italian architects to supervise the reconstruction of the Kremlin.

The newly - built stronghold was a massive brick wall with 20 towers.

It surrounded the most important buildings, the construction of which was continued later.

Now the Kremlin is one of the most ancient parts of the city.

Each corner has one tower.

The tallest tower of the whole Kremlin complex is the the Troitskaya Tower.

One of the most popular towers is the Spasskaya Tower.

Its senior architect was the famous Pietro Solari.

The main Kremlin clock is situated here.

The Kremlin is also the the seat of the Russian government.

The Grand Kremlin Palace is the principal building, and the through - passage to it is located in the Nikolskaya Tower.

The complex serves as the residence of the President of the Russian Federation.

The Ivan the Great Bell Tower is renowned for once being the tallest building in old Moscow and the tallest belfry in Russia.

The Tsar Bell was installed nearby.

It is the world’s largest bell and it weighs about 200 tons.

The famous Tsar Cannon was constructed in 1586.

The kremlin

The Kremlin is the heart of Moscow.

It is the oldest historical and architectural centre of Moscow.

First it was a wooden fortress.

Under Dmitry Donskoy the Kremlin was built of white stone.

During the reign of Ivan III the walls of white stone were replaced by new red bri ck walls and towers.

The Tsar invited Italian architects to construct the cathedrals.

The Assumption Cathedral was built in 1475 - ^ 1479 and all Russian Tsars and Emper­ors were crowned there.

The Archangel Cathedral was the burial place of the Russian Princes and Tsars.

The An - nuiciation Cathedral was built in 1484.

It is famous for the icons painted by Andrey Rublev and his apprentices.

Ivan the Great is the Bell Tower, one of the most re­markable structures of the 16 - th century.

It rises in the certre of the Kremlin.

It unites all the Kremlin Cathe­drals into a majestic ensemble.

On the stone pedestal at the foot of the Bell Tower there is a Tsar - Bell — the largest bell in the world.

Not far from it one can see a Tsar - Cannon.

Another fine example of Russian architecture is the Faceted Palace.

It was built in 1487 - 91.

- - One of the well - known Kremlin museums is the Ar­moury Chamber.

It was built in 1851.

The famous gold­en cap of Monomach, the first Russian imperial crown of Catherine II, made of gilt silver and many other pre­cious historical items are exhibited there.
